    This was explained long ago in a thread in the housing forum. The gist of it is all those things you see in a dungeon are not individual items. Each item in your house has to be referenced in relation to every other item in your house. You see a table, four chairs, four cups, six plates, and 10 assorted other items in a dungeon the server sees one item. If one moves they all move. In your house that is 25 items. Delves are instanced. We see a loading screen when we enter them. If all those items were treated like housing items the loading screens would be much longer than they are now.
    Because you can move all those items independent of each other the server treats them much different.
